Did you think about maybe getting on the internet and using Instant Messenger to contact the family? I have done that in the past and it worked very well for us.

You may or may not have cell phone service while at sea. And depending upon where we are, you may be making international calling. I would give Verizon a call. When I had my Verizon phone, I lost service as we pulled out shortly after sailaway. I did have service while in the Bahamas, but don't recall if I ever did call home from there - don't think I did since I was IM'ing them anyway.

Packing was easy. I've been playing with my spreadsheet for weeks now. First I start with all the days, what is happening on that day and what we are going to wear. Then on another tab I list all the items that need to be packed and what piece they need to go in. On this one I have a space next to each to check off as it is packed. Then finally is a listing of all the bags that need to go in the car with check-offs. Believe it or not we once went away for the weekend and left our notebook at home. Not a biggie but we had intended to bring it and we each thought the other had put it in the car. Now I make a checklist.
